Shielding a Telecaster

This Tele belongs to Christian Driver. He brought it to me describing static like noise that made it no fun to play his guitar. This is a very common problem for guitars using single coil pickups, especially telecasters, so the shielding is by far the most requested modification I do. I love doing this mod for players because extra static noise (60 cycle hum) from the pickups can really ruin a great guitar (or jam session / band practice / worship set too)

This tele has a lot of soul in it's tone- that you couldn't feel and hear over the hum and noise before, but now it sings.
